Dan Snyder is not going to fire Spurrier this year or next year. I admit it does look pretty bad with reports begining to come out that vinny is in dans ear to kick Spurrier out the door. Put all the football aside and the reason spurrier will stay is because of money . Spurrier has been so open about the fact that he will leave after three years if the ship is not turned around ,why would dan fire him now and have to pay him the remainder of the 25 million dollar contract to let him go when he will leave on his own and dan gets some of his money back.

The road Dan takes i think is to keep Spurrier on as the head coach and surround him with the best assistants he can get to come to washington. Spurrier does have to agree with this due to him haveing complete control over his staff ,however if Sonny Jurgenson was right and Spurrier was the one who asked dan to bring in the consultants then i dont think he will object to some new assistants.

Snyder will appear patient and true to his word which would save some face around the league so he wouldnt be black balled by veteran NFL coaches around the leauge as well as save him some money. From the dan perspective he probably would have just implanted the next head coach of the washington redskins disquised as a assistant if Spurrier should fail, that way the next coach will be familiar with the team and the systems when and if he takes over.

I said this in another thread and now I will say it again

I can think of about 25 million reasons why Synder won't fire Spurrier. Remember what happened with Marty? He wouldn't accept the changes that Synder wanted to impose so he got the boot. But because Snyder fired Marty after just one season, but because he did that, he had to pay out the rest of the contract of 4 years, $10 millon. So he had to pay out the full $10 million for a single season.

If Snyder fires Spurrier, he wil have to pay out 25 million for just 2 seasons.
